Enhanced extrinsic absorption promotes the visible light photocatalytic activity of wide band-gap (BiO)2CO3 hierarchical structure†
Ting Xiong,Fan Dong,Zhongbiao Wu
RSC Advances Pub Date : 10/16/2014 00:00:00 , DOI:10.1039/C4RA10786A
Abstract

(BiO)2CO3 hierarchical microspheres and (BiO)2CO3 nanoparticles with wide band-gaps were fabricated by a simple hydrothermal method. The former showed higher visible light photocatalytic activity towards the removal of NO than the latter due to the enhanced extrinsic absorption benefiting from the strong light reflecting and scattering effects. The extrinsic absorption over (BiO)2CO3 hierarchical microspheres can induce the production of holes and electrons with visible light, subsequently generating active species to participate in photocatalytic reactions.
